Horse racing is a sport where luck often goes hand in hand with skill and experience. I’m talking about for the photographers as well as for the jockeys and betters. I shot this photo a split second before they crossed the finish line at Keeneland Race Track. I was happy with it because of how the first four finishers lined up so perfectly and how colorful they all were against the green grass. What I didn’t realize at the time was that the winning jockey, Mike Smith, was kissing his mount as they won the race. That was a surprise I got when I enlarged it later.
